Can anyone tell me what risk assessments we are required to have?
I am getting my things up together as due an inspection anytime now and dont want to make more work for myself than is necessary!
Thanks:rolleyes:
sarah707
06-02-2009, 11:32 AM
One for every room of your house... one for your garden... one for every type of outing... one for activities... one for cleaning stuff (COSHH)... one for children if they help with cooking etc... one for anywhere children are not allowed to go... one for your car including car paperwork...
I think that's about it :D
